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 cup cooked rice or quinoa
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• ½ cucumber, diced
  • ¼ red onion, thinly sliced
  • ½ cup feta cheese, crumbled
  • ½ cup tzatziki sauce

Instructions

  1. Marinate the chicken by whisking together ol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, oregano,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. Coat the chicken and let it marinate for at least 30 minutes.
  2. Cook the marinated chicken in a skillet over medium heat for about 5–6 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through. Allow to rest before slicing.
  3. Assemble bowls with rice or quinoa as the base. Top each bowl with sliced chicken,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, red onion, crumbled feta cheese, and drizzle with tzatziki sauce.
  4. Serve immediately while warm.
